Altor Fund VI (”Altor”) has signed an agreement to acquire a majority stake in Eltera Gruppen AS (“Eltera”), from Valedo Partners III AB (”Valedo”). Eltera’s management will reinvest in the company. Altor will support the company and existing management to accelerate its growth journey into both current and new markets.
Since its founding in 2013, Eltera has grown into the leading Norwegian provider of electrical installation services, focused on service and maintenance within non-residential end-markets. The company has a full national coverage in Norway with over 30 operating entities and more than 1000 employees. Eltera is built on a decentralised model combining local entrepreneurship and decision-making with scale benefits through collective strength and centralised support.
